Definitions
- a vertical impact mill 2 a classifier 3, a finished product discharge device 4 and a conveying device 5 for returning the insufficiently comminuted bulk material portions into the area of the material feed device 6, which is arranged above the vertical impact mill 2.
- the material is introduced, for example, via a cellular wheel sluice 7 into the material feed device 6 designed as a shaft, so that no false air can penetrate into the system.
- the material falls on the distributor divider 8, which is provided with guide vanes 9.
- the distributor divider 8 can be driven in rotation by means of a drive 10. Via the guide vanes 9, the supplied material is introduced into a bed 11 in which the main comminution work takes place.
- the air flow generated by the fan action of the guide vanes which is directed essentially radially or tangentially, there are no disruptive air influences from air that may be rising or supplied from outside.
